    SINCE 1957
    Maryland FBLA was established in April 1957, with the first chartered chapter at Forest Park High School in Baltimore. There are five administrative regions in Maryland FBLA, each headed by a Regional Vice President. In January, each region hold a competitions to decide the members eligible to compete at the State Leadership Conference in the spring. Members placing first, second, third, or fourth in their competitive event at the SLC are eligible to compete at the National Leadership Conference hosted by National FBLA-PBL.
